EducationJAMB Gives Date For Close Of 2015 Admission Processes by teejaypee(op): 4:10pm On Jul 15, 2015
The Joint Admission and Matriculation Board, Following the decisions reached in the policy meeting held yesterday has mandated institutions to conclude all admission processes on or before October 31st, 2015.
It was also decided that the 2015/2016 admission would be 60:40 ration in favour of science courses to Art courses and ration 70:30 for courses in Technology and non technology courses respectively.
This simply implies that science candidates stand a better chance of getting admitted this year than their arts counterparts.
Similarly, candidates who chose technology related courses will stand a better chance of getting admitted than their counterparts going for non-technology courses
